Boliven offers access to PubMed patent, clinical trials, device and drug data -

Boliven Publications, a free scientific abstract and bibliographic information service for Boliven Network Members, has announced that it now includes nearly 20 million PubMed citations and articles for free use by its members. It also offers weblinks to related free data in clinical trials, patents and FDA drug and device data.

Scientists, doctors and IP professionals can now expect to quickly and easily link between patent data, PubMed citation data and clinical trials data. This in turn is projected to speed up collaboration, open innovation and, eventually, the development of life-saving medicines. Features and capabilities of Boliven's PubMed integration include links to patents, clinical trials, drugs and medical devices data; Work Portfolio and Innovation Network Integration; and PartnerMatch Integration.

Under Work Portfolio and Innovation Network Integration, scientific authors included in the PubMed dataset can create a Work Portfolio of their publications, clinical trials and patents and expand their Innovation Network on Boliven for free by joining. As members save PubMed abstracts and articles to their Work Portfolio, Boliven will recommend other scientists and biomedical researchers who have common interests and might make good partners for new research activities.

Boliven also offers the ability to search by MeSH terms and other features found on PubMed. Over 5,000 leading scientists, doctors, patent attorneys, technology entrepreneurs, executives, and investors are participating in the Boliven Network, according to the company.
